Working Principles

The SS32-M3/57T operates based on the principles of semiconductor diode rectification and voltage regulation. When forward-biased, it allows current to flow in one direction, while blocking it in the reverse direction, enabling efficient conversion of alternating current (AC) to direct current (DC).

Seznam 10 běžných otázek a odpovědí souvisejících s aplikací SS32-M3/57T v technických řešeních

  1. What is the SS32-M3/57T?

    • The SS32-M3/57T is a surface mount Schottky barrier rectifier diode designed for general-purpose applications.
  2. What are the key features of the SS32-M3/57T?

    • The key features include a low forward voltage drop, high current capability, and a compact surface mount package.
  3. What are the typical applications of the SS32-M3/57T?

    • Typical applications include polarity protection, freewheeling diodes, and power supply output rectification.
  4. What is the maximum forward voltage of the SS32-M3/57T?

    • The maximum forward voltage is typically around 0.55V at a forward current of 3A.
  5. What is the maximum reverse voltage of the SS32-M3/57T?

    • The maximum reverse voltage is 20V.
  6. What is the operating temperature range of the SS32-M3/57T?

    • The operating temperature range is typically from -65°C to +125°C.
